Output 5d59e5c1cef1f367ac2c98c2e3d7a6131e94e23cb099a03753585093560c5e10:0

value
603148756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3b76fd9dbc285dfe094466b2980a98ff8b58cd OP_EQUAL
address
34Mako1ZKT8Lgwo5qXXjUBoQCv6ULxhBW3
transaction
5d59e5c1cef1f367ac2c98c2e3d7a6131e94e23cb099a03753585093560c5e10
spent
true